Redefining Narrative Engagement: From Passive Consumption to Active Participation

Historically, literature and film offered passive modes of storytelling—viewers absorbed stories authored by others, with limited influence over the outcome. Today’s digital landscape, however, fosters an active role for audiences, transforming them into co-creators within a narrative space. Interactive experiences such as augmented reality (AR), virtual reality (VR), and bespoke web applications enable users to navigate complex story arcs, often influenced by psychological themes like perception, identity, and perception of reality.

The Role of Psychological Themes in Interactive Media

Incorporating psychological themes into digital narratives enhances their depth and authenticity. For instance, exploring concepts like cognitive biases, hallucination, or madness can offer profound insights into human behavior. Such themes are often central to experimental storytelling, where the goal is to evoke empathy, understanding, or even discomfort—prompting reflection on our own mental frameworks.
